slufan13 Posted July 9, 2015 Share Posted July 9, 2015 Showing interest in Dru Smith, a 6'2 guard out of Indy. Also http://www.verbalcommits.com/players/dru-smith http://www.indystar.com/story/sports/high-school/2015/07/08/eron-gordon-says-will-look-lsu/29895025/ A big reason for Reitz's success was the play of guard Dru Smith. The high-energy 6-2 guard wasn't a big-time scorer (10.5 ppg) but filled the stat sheet in other ways (5.4 rebounds, 4.5 assists and 3.6 steals). "On that team, I tried to play hard defense and get our fast breaks going," Smith said. "I feel like colleges like how I play on the defensive end. My senior year I'm going to have to score a lot more." Smith has offers from Ball State, Evansville, Indiana State, Northern Kentucky and South Alabama. Bradley, Loyola (Ill.) and Saint Louis have also been in contact and all had coaches at his game with Pocket City on Wednesday night at North Central. Butler's Lewis also watched his game before watching Gordon. Evansville coach Marty Simmons and Ball State coach James Whitford were also in attendance. "I'm just kind of waiting through July before I sit down and figure everything out," Smith said. "I'll probably take two or three official visits. I kind of want to play uptempo, but mostly I'm looking for a program that is going in the right direction. I'd like to make an impact right away but I don't expect to be given anything."
